For agents — one clean interface

An agent enrolls into a team with a join token, fetches the effective policy it's graded against, and reports liveness — over plain HTTP or MCP. It just works.

POST /api/v1/agent/enroll  { "join_token": "otji-…" }
GET  /api/v1/agent/policy?modality=text
POST /api/v1/agent/heartbeat { "status": "online" }

A policy hierarchy that only tightens

Each level can only raise the bar, never lower it. An agent is always graded against the strictest combination that applies to it.

SeaOtter default
The hostile-by-default floor — never softened.
Org policy
Your organization tightens the bar.
Team policy
Each team tightens further for its risk domain.

Teams, hierarchically

Group agents into teams — business units, cost centers, regulatory domains. Teams nest, so a parent team's policy flows down to its children.

❡

Git-like policy control

Author acceptance policies with full version control: a commit log, diffs between versions, one-click rollback, and fork-to-tighten. Every change is auditable.

▣

Live acceptance rates

Watch each team's ship / route / block mix, throughput, cost, and agent liveness in real time — the AgentOS control plane, scoped to your org.

✦

Agents join & get managed

Mint a join token; an agent enrolls with one call and is instantly graded against its team's effective policy. No redeploy, no config drift.

🖼

Multimodal & large artifacts

Condition a policy on concrete exemplars — a gold deck, a reference image, a spreadsheet — content-addressed and deduped, inline or by object-store pointer.

☻

Roles & access

Owner, admin, member, viewer. Give people exactly the access they need; the gate and every verdict stay defensible and signed.
